The "Advance/High Skill Training in Coir" Component of the "Development of Coir" Scheme by the Department of Industries and Commerce, Union Territory of Puducherry, aims to enhance the skills of Coir artisans and interested individuals. The objective is to acquire the latest skills and modern technologies through advanced/high-skilled training available across various locations in India, offering valuable benefits to eligible candidates.

Who qualifies

  • The applicant must either be a native of Puducherry or have been a continuous resident for the past 3 years.
  • The age limit for applicants is between 18 to 35 years.
  • Educational qualifications should meet the standards specified by the Training Units/Institutions.
  • Candidates who have already undergone this training are not eligible to apply.

What you get

  • Trainees receive a stipend of ₹2,500 per month.
  • Accommodation charges for trainees are ₹500 per month.
  • Travelling allowance covers to-and-fro 2nd class sleeper train fare.
  • Full course fees are paid to the training units/institutions as prescribed.
